City Overview

Twin Falls sits in south-central Idaho with a population around 50,000, making it the perfect mid-sized city for sports tournaments and group events. The city is famous for the dramatic Snake River Canyon that cuts right through town, creating stunning views and the iconic Perrine Bridge where daredevils BASE jump year-round.

The sports scene here is surprisingly robust for a city this size. Twin Falls has invested heavily in youth athletics infrastructure and regularly hosts regional tournaments across multiple sports. The community takes pride in their facilities, and you'll find well-maintained fields, courts, and complexes that rival much larger cities. Plus, the smaller scale means less traffic chaos and easier navigation for tournament families.

This is an agricultural hub with a down-to-earth vibe - expect genuine friendliness from locals and reasonable prices compared to bigger Idaho cities like Boise. The elevation sits around 3,700 feet, so you'll notice the crisp, dry air and intense sunshine that makes outdoor tournaments particularly enjoyable.

Getting Around

Magic Valley Regional Airport (TWF) is tiny - you'll mainly connect through Salt Lake City or Boise if you're flying in. Most tournament groups drive here since Twin Falls sits right on I-84, making it easily accessible from across the region. You're looking at 2.5 hours from Boise, 3.5 hours from Salt Lake City, and about 5 hours from Spokane.

Forget public transit - there's basically none worth mentioning. Uber and Lyft exist but with limited drivers, so don't count on quick pickups during peak tournament times. Your best bet is renting cars or bringing your own vehicles. All major rental companies operate out of the small airport, and several have locations in town.

The good news? Twin Falls is compact and easy to navigate. Most sports venues are within 10-15 minutes of downtown hotels, and traffic is rarely an issue except during morning and evening rush hours on Blue Lakes Boulevard. Parking is generally free and abundant at most venues and attractions.

Where to Stay

Your best bet for hotels is along Blue Lakes Boulevard, the main north-south corridor that connects I-84 to downtown. This strip has most of the national chain hotels and puts you within easy reach of sports complexes and restaurants. The Hampton Inn, Holiday Inn Express, and Best Western Plus here are solid choices for tournament groups.

If your tournament is at Sunway Soccer Complex or other westside venues, consider staying near the Pole Line Road area where you'll find newer hotels like the Fairfield Inn. For events downtown or at Twin Falls High School facilities, hotels closer to Shoshone Falls Road work well.

Avoid the budget motels near the truck stops unless you're truly desperate - they're not worth the savings for team stays. Most of the quality hotels offer tournament rates and have pools, which teams always appreciate after long competition days.

Sports & Recreation

Sunway Soccer Complex is the crown jewel - multiple full-sized fields with excellent drainage that can handle Idaho's unpredictable spring weather. It regularly hosts regional soccer tournaments and has become a destination for teams across the Northwest. The Twin Falls County Fairgrounds transforms into various sports venues depending on the season, hosting everything from rodeos to indoor tournaments.

Sawtooth Elementary Sports Complex offers quality baseball and softball diamonds, while the high school facilities at Twin Falls High School and Canyon Ridge High School provide top-notch football, track, and multi-sport venues. The Twin Falls City Pool and aquatic center host swimming competitions and water polo tournaments.

Basketball tournaments often use the high school gyms or the College of Southern Idaho facilities just outside town. Wrestling is huge here - expect well-organized tournaments with enthusiastic local crowds. The area also sees volleyball, tennis, and track and field events throughout the year, with most venues offering good spectator amenities and concessions.

Things to Do

Shoshone Falls is unmissable - often called the "Niagara of the West," it's spectacular in spring when snowmelt creates thundering cascades. The viewing area is just 10 minutes from most hotels, perfect for a quick team photo opportunity. Perrine Bridge offers incredible canyon views and you might catch BASE jumpers in action - kids are always amazed by this.

Centennial Waterfront Park provides a great spot for teams to stretch their legs between games, with walking trails and river access. The Herrett Center for Arts and Science at CSI features a planetarium and museum that work well for rainy day activities. Twin Falls City Park has playground equipment and open spaces perfect for team bonding time.

For day trips, Balanced Rock and Pillar Falls offer unique geological formations within 20 minutes of town. Cauldron Linn provides more dramatic scenery for families wanting Instagram-worthy shots. Most of these outdoor attractions are free and don't require much time commitment - perfect for tournament schedules.

Food & Drink

Twin Falls punches above its weight for food options. Jakers Bar and Grill is the go-to for team dinners - they handle large groups well and serve solid steaks and comfort food. Elevation 486 offers upscale dining with canyon views, great for celebrating tournament wins or coach dinners.

For quick team meals, you'll find all the usual suspects: McDonald's, Subway, Taco Bell, and Pizza Hut scattered throughout town. Grocery Outlet and WinCo Foods work well for teams needing to stock up on snacks and drinks. Local favorite Buffalo Cafe serves massive breakfast portions that fuel athletes for long tournament days.

Koto Steakhouse combines hibachi entertainment with team-friendly group seating - always a hit with youth teams. La Fiesta delivers reliable Mexican food with generous portions and quick service. Most restaurants here are family-owned and genuinely care about providing good service to visiting teams, often offering group discounts if you call ahead.

Weather & Packing

Twin Falls weather can be tricky - the high desert climate means big temperature swings between day and night, even in summer. Spring tournaments (March-May) require layers since you might see 70°F afternoons and 35°F mornings. Pack warm-ups, jackets, and rain gear since spring storms pop up quickly and can be intense.

Summer tournaments are generally ideal - dry heat with temperatures in the 80s-90s, but minimal humidity makes it comfortable. Pack extra sunscreen and hats; the high elevation and clear skies create deceiving sun intensity that burns quickly. Winter events mean snow and temperatures often below freezing, but most winter tournaments move indoors anyway.

Wind can be brutal here, especially at exposed fields like the soccer complex. Bring tent stakes and weights if you're setting up team canopies. Peak tournament season runs April through October, with July and August being busiest. Always pack layers regardless of season - Idaho weather changes fast, and being prepared beats being miserable during long tournament days.

Local Tips

Download the GasBuddy app - gas prices vary significantly between stations here, and tournament families appreciate saving a few bucks per fill-up. Costco gas is usually cheapest if you have a membership. Park early at popular venues like Sunway Soccer Complex during big tournaments - spaces fill up fast and there's limited overflow parking.

Local referees and tournament directors are generally excellent - this community takes youth sports seriously and invests in quality officiating. Bring cash for concessions at most venues; many don't accept cards. The Twin Falls Visitor Center stocks discount coupons for restaurants and attractions that can add up to real savings for large groups.

Safety isn't a major concern, but be aware that cell service can be spotty in some parts of the canyon areas if you're exploring between games. Most hotels offer free breakfast that's actually decent - take advantage since restaurant options for large groups can be limited during busy tournament weekends. Book dinner reservations ahead of time, especially for groups larger than eight people.
